uPVC windows can have problems opening or locking. This is usually the case when the locking system is stiff or sluggish. If this is the case, a simple solution is to utilize graphite powder or machine oil to grease the lock and handle mechanism. This will allow the mechanism to be freed up and the window or door to function as normal.

Another issue that can be found with uPVC windows is that the hinges can become stiff or stuck. This problem is commonly caused by grit and dust accumulating on the hinges over time. Lubricating the hinges with oil or grease is the solution. A poor lubricant could damage the hinges and make them unusable.

Stained Glass Repairs

Stained glass windows can be found in homes, churches and other buildings. They add visual interest and privacy to a room. However, they can be quite fragile and need to be kept in good order to ensure they remain in good shape. Even with the best care, stained and leaded glass windows can deteriorate over time due to age and exposure to the elements and weather elements. This causes a range of problems such as cracks, fading, and water leakage. If you own a stained or leaded glass window that requires repair, it's important to locate an expert local to restore the window to its original splendor.

The cost for repairing cracked or broken stained-glass is $500. The cost will differ based on the solution that is required to fix the issue. For example professional technicians may use copper foil or Upvc repairs epoxy edge-gluing to repair the broken glass. They can also re-lead lead cames, and then reseal the stained glass. There are several alternatives, each with their own pros and cons. The selection of the most suitable solution will depend on the size of the crack, its location and the type of material used to create the glass.

Leaded glass cracks may be caused by thermal expansion and contraction, building movements or just normal wear and tear. The cracks may grow and cause bigger problems as time passes. To prevent further damage and expansion any crack that crosses an important feature of stained-glass panels or their face must be fixed as fast as possible. The past was when this was typically accomplished by splicing a "Dutchman" lead flange on top of the crack. This was a bad method of repair and is no longer the case. There are much better ways to fix cracks of this type.

Stained glass restoration is a specific art that can take many forms. It can be as easy as repairing cracks, or as complicated as restoring an entire stained glass window or door panel back to its original condition. In general, the price for a complete restoration is more expensive than the cost of a simple repair. This is due to the fact that the process involves cleaning and removing damaged or soiled glass, tightening the lead cames, resealing and re-tying cement and replacing missing pieces of stained glass.

Weatherstripping Repairs

Weatherstripping blocks air and water from entering homes through the gaps that surround windows and doors. It's an essential element of home maintenance and can reduce the need for costly repairs or energy bills, as well in making homes more comfortable. However the materials used in the seal may degrade as time passes due to wear and tear, which makes it important to replace the seals from time to time.

You can detect the weather stripping is worn out by noticing a spot that is wet after washing your windows, a whistling sound when driving, or a draft that you feel inside an unlocked door. All of these are good indicators to locate a Tasker in my area who can provide weatherstripping repair.

Taskers can make use of various weatherstripping materials to seal your doors and windows. Foam tapes are made of open-cell or closed cell foam. They come in different sizes, thicknesses, and widths. These are easy to install and can be cut using scissors. Felt strips are likewise inexpensive and last for about a year or two. They can be cut in length using scissors and glued to the door frame or hinge side of a double-hung or sliding window with glue, staples, or tacks. Vinyl or metal V-strips are slightly more difficult to install but they can be nailed into place along a window jamb.
